Laszlo's Roadmap

Laszlo开发分为2个分枝:

LPS 2.2是主枝,优先负责稳定性和修复bug,这个是商业化的推荐方向,同时该版本的不支持3.0的特性。

LPS 3.0是开发版分枝。LPS 3.0的主要特性是不依赖服务器的部署方式、支持Unicode、整合浏览器、调整应用程序大小和速度。由LPS 3.0创建的应用程序将需要flash 6或更高版本的支持,这个将带来一些其他的特性。


 



LPS 2.2.1

修正2.2的一个bug。修补了在使用SOAPXML-RPC时候的执行效率缺陷。这个版本的源代码和安装程序将在十一月的早期发布。

LPS 3.0 beta 1

LPS 3.0的源代码将由OpenLaszlo.org在十一月中期发布。这个Beta版本将包括以下特性:

Unicode

发布版本将支持unicode文本,包括:程序源代码、用户界面元素、请求数据和返回数据。

 

Client fonts

LPS 2.2只支持嵌入的字体,这个限制了执行性能并增大了应用程序的体积,这个版本将取消这个限制。

 

Canvas resizing

应用程序可以再运行时候根据浏览器窗口的大小来调整自身大小。.

 

Internal compression

LPS 2.2使用gzip编码,这个可以减小传输量,但在浏览器缓存中的应用程序体积依然很大。内部压缩机制可以在文件内部中感知和判断是否需要使用gzip来处理,这样浏览器就不需要另外再进行解压缩处理。

 

LPS 3.0 beta 2

LPS 3.0的第二个Beta版本计划在2005年初期发布,将增加以下几个特性:

后退按钮(Back button)

整合浏览器的“后退”按钮

 

服务器独立(Serverless deployment)

可以将编译过的应用程序部署在没有Laszlo Presentation Server运行的Web服务器上。

 

绘图API(Drawing API)

可以通过程序API来创建图形。

 

动态加载类库(Dynamically-loaded libraries)

这个机制将初始化应用程序不需的部分代码延期下载。

 

 

posted @ 2004-12-20 16:30  dannyr|一个都不能少!  阅读(1022)  评论(1)    收藏  举报